WebDNA is a long polymer made from repeating units called nucleotides. The structure of DNA is dynamic along its length, being capable of coiling into tight loops and other shapes. In all species it is composed of two helical chains, bound to each other by hydrogen bonds.Both chains are coiled around the same axis, and have the same pitch of 34 ångströms (3.4 nm). WebClick Helix and Spiral (Curves toolbar) or Insert > Curve > Helix/Spiral . Defined By Specifies the type of curve (helix or spiral) and which parameters to use to define the curve. Select one of the following: Parameters Sets parameters of the curve. Your selection under Defined By determines which parameters are available.
